Introduction
BBQ franchises are becoming increasingly popular, appealing to meat lovers and families. This presents unique opportunities for entrepreneurs.
Investment Overview
BBQ franchises generally require an investment of $150,000 to $500,000, including franchise fees and startup costs.
Benefits
Franchisees enjoy brand recognition, operational support, and a loyal customer base.
Risks
Risks include competition in the BBQ market and sourcing quality ingredients.
How to Get Started
Start by exploring different BBQ franchises, understanding their offerings, and contacting them for details.
